UAV Show (Bordeaux)
The European Professional Trade Show for Defense and Dual-Use Drones is a key gathering for civil and military UAV professionals. It combines an exhibition hall, conferences, and live flight demonstrations and is widely regarded as one of the continent’s premier drone trade events.
Highlights:
- Civil & defense UAV systems
- Industry networking and deal-making
- Live demonstrations

Intergeo (Germany)
One of Europe’s biggest geospatial and surveying trade fairs, Intergeo is a must-visit for UAV professionals working in mapping, land management, 3D modelling, and GNSS-assisted aerial data capture. Drones are a core part of discussions around data workflows and spatial intelligence.
Highlights:
- Survey & mapping technology
- Geospatial workflows using UAVs
- Cross-industry data solutions

Defense & Security Exhibitions With UAV Focus
Exhibitions such as Eurosatory (Paris) and MSPO (Poland) are large defence and security trade fairs where UAV systems — especially those used for surveillance, ISR, and tactical missions — are prominently showcased. Eurosoatory’s live demonstration zones often feature drones and robotic systems relevant to security operations.
